#D77940 Hex Color Code

#D77940

The Hexadecimal Color #D77940 is a contrast shade of Peru. #D77940 RGB value is rgb(215, 121, 64). RGB Color Model of #D77940 consists of 84% red, 47% green and 25% blue. HSL color Mode of #D77940 has 23°(degrees) Hue, 65% Saturation and 55% Lightness. #D77940 color has an wavelength of 605.51852n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#D77940 is #FF9966.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#D77940 is #D74. The Closest Color to #D77940 is #CD853F. Official Name of #D77940 Hex Code is Raw Sienna.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#D77940 is 0 Cyan 44 Magenta 70 Yellow 16 Black and #D77940 CMY is 0, 44, 70.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#D77940 is hsl(23,65,55,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(23, 70, 84).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#D77940 is 35.79, 28.5, 8.46.
Hex8 Value of #D77940 is #D77940FF. Decimal Value of #D77940 is 14121280 and Octal Value of #D77940 is 65674500. Binary Value of #D77940 is 11010111, 1111001, 1000000 and Android of #D77940 is 4292311360 / 0xffd77940.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#D77940 is 0.492, 0.392, 0.392 and YIQ Color Space of #D77940 is 142.608, 74.3287, 2.1426.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#D77940 is 37.1, 23.25, 8.81.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#D77940 is 60.34, 32.02, 46.27.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#D77940 is 60.34, 74.61, 44.35.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#D77940 is 60.34, 56.27, 55.32. Hunter Lab variable of #D77940 is 53.39, 26.24, 27.97.

Analogous and Monochromatic Colors of #D77940

Analogous colors are groups of hues that are located next to each other on the color wheel. These colors share a similar undertone and create a sense of harmony when used together. Analogous color schemes are mainly used in design or art to create a sense of cohesion and flow in a color scheme composition.

Monochromatic colors refer to a color scheme that uses variations of a single color. These variations are achieved by adjusting the shade, tint, or tone of the base color. Monochromatic approach is commonly used in interior design or fashion to create a sense of understated elegance and give a sense of simplicity and consistency.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#D77940

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
